pycharm中生成二维码的库,python、
时间: 2024-05-18 10:17:35 浏览: 84
PyCharm本身并没有专门的生成二维码的库,但是你可以使用Python的qrcode库来在PyCharm中生成二维码。安装qrcode库的方法如下:
1. 打开PyCharm,创建一个新的Python项目。
2. 在PyCharm的Terminal中输入以下命令来安装qrcode库:
```
pip install qrcode
```
3. 安装完成后,在PyCharm的Python文件中,使用以下代码来生成二维码:
```python
import qrcode
img = qrcode.make('https://www.google.com')
img.save('google.png')
```
这个代码会生成一个链接到Google的二维码,并将其保存为PNG格式的图片。你可以通过调整生成二维码的参数来自定义二维码的大小、颜色和形状等属性。
相关问题
pycharm生成二维码
PyCharm 是一款集成开发环境,主要用于 Python 开发,但它本身并不直接提供生成二维码的功能。如果你想在 PyCharm 中生成二维码,通常需要借助外部库,如 `qrcode` 或 `pyzbar` 等。以下是一个简单的步骤:
1. 安装库:首先通过 pip 安装 QRCode 库,例如 `pip install qrcode[pil]`,如果使用的是 pyzbar,则安装 `pip install pyzbar`.
2. 编写代码:在 PyCharm 中创建一个新的 Python 文件,导入所需的库,然后可以使用如下的代码生成二维码:
```python
import qrcode
# 创建一个包含数据的二维码
data = "这里是你要编码的信息"
img = qrcode.make(data)
# 保存为图片文件
img.save('output.png') # 可以更改为你想要的文件名和路径
```
如果你使用的是 pyzbar,生成二维码的过程可能会稍有不同,但基本原理类似。
Matlab生成自己名字的二维码
Matlab是一种强大的数值计算和可视化工具,但它本身并不直接提供创建二维码的功能。不过,你可以通过结合使用Matlab与其他软件或者库来实现这个目标。例如:
1. 首先,你需要一个字符串,即你想包含在二维码中的内容,这通常是"Matlab"加上你的名字。
2. 使用Matlab可以读取外部文件,比如Python的`qrcode`库,通过调用其API来生成二维码图片。你需要在命令窗口中导入所需的Python模块,然后编写脚本生成二维码。
```matlab
% 导入Python运行环境(如果你安装了PyCharm等支持Python交互)
pyversion = 'python3';
addpath(pyversion);
% 创建二维码的Python代码
script = ['import qrcode'];
script = [script, '; qr = qrcode.QRCode()'];
script = [script, '; qr.add_data("YourNameHereMatlab")']; % "YourNameHere"替换为你的名字
script = [script, '; qr.make(fit=True)'];
script = [script, '; img = qr.make_image(fill=''black'', back_color=''white'')'];
script = [script, '; saveas(img, ''matlab_name_qr.png'')'];
% 运行Python代码
eval(script);
```
3. 这段脚本会生成一个名为`matlab_name_qr.png`的PNG文件,这就是你的名字对应的二维码。
阅读全文